What is XR and How Can It Influence Climate Change Activism?

Extended Reality (XR) is a broad term that encompasses Virtual Reality (VR), Augmented Reality (AR), and Mixed Reality (MR) technologies, which blend the physical and digital worlds in different ways. Each of these technologies has unique capabilities, but all of them share the ability to immerse users in interactive, often life-like environments that can drive emotional engagement and behavioral change.

  • Virtual Reality (VR): VR fully immerses users in a digital environment, isolating them from the real world. It can simulate a variety of experiences, such as witnessing the effects of natural disasters, exploring the Amazon rainforest, or experiencing a flooded city.
  • Augmented Reality (AR): AR overlays digital information on top of the physical world. This allows users to interact with both real and virtual elements simultaneously. For example, AR can be used to visualize the effects of climate change in specific locations, such as rising sea levels in coastal cities or the impact of deforestation in rainforests.
  • Mixed Reality (MR): MR blends elements of both AR and VR, allowing users to interact with digital objects in the real world and vice versa. This immersive experience is ideal for creating interactive educational tools that combine real-time data with simulations of climate change scenarios.

The Role of XR in Climate Change Activism

The unique immersive nature of XR technologies offers the potential to transform how climate change activism is conducted. These tools can help communicate complex environmental issues in ways that engage people on a deeply emotional and cognitive level, inspiring action and facilitating understanding. Here are some key ways XR is being used to drive climate change activism:


1. Raising Awareness Through Immersive Experiences

One of the most powerful ways XR can impact climate change activism is by creating immersive experiences that allow users to experience the devastating effects of climate change firsthand.

  • Virtual Reality Climate Crisis Simulations: VR can transport users to locations that are suffering from the consequences of climate change, such as shrinking glaciers, decimated coral reefs, or communities displaced by rising sea levels. These simulations enable people to “feel” the urgency of the climate crisis. For instance, VR documentaries like The Last Reef take viewers to underwater ecosystems, showing the devastating effects of coral bleaching and ocean acidification. Such experiences create empathy by immersing users in the lived experience of those suffering from environmental degradation, motivating them to support activism.
  • Environmental Impact Visualizations: Through VR, activists and organizations can bring people into immersive 3D simulations of environmental damage. These visualizations can show the dramatic impacts of deforestation, forest fires, or habitat loss on wildlife. As an example, immersive projects such as The Polar Bears’ Dream allow users to explore the Arctic region, where the polar bear’s habitat is being threatened by melting ice due to global warming.

The emotional and psychological impact of experiencing these scenarios often drives stronger advocacy, as users gain a visceral understanding of the climate emergency.


2. Empowering Action Through Gamification and Virtual Campaigns

XR can also help activists mobilize support for climate action through gamification and virtual campaigns. By turning climate activism into an engaging, interactive experience, XR encourages individuals to take meaningful steps toward sustainable behavior.

  • Virtual Protests and Rallies: XR can facilitate virtual protests or rallies, allowing users to join climate change campaigns from the comfort of their homes. These virtual events simulate the atmosphere of real-world protests, and participants can engage with others globally in a collaborative, impactful environment. Activists and organizations can use MR technologies to create interactive experiences where individuals can sign petitions, learn about environmental issues, or share personal climate stories, fostering a sense of solidarity.
  • Eco-Gaming: Environmental-themed video games that integrate AR and VR are increasingly popular in raising awareness about climate issues. Games like Eco allow players to work together in a virtual world to balance economic growth with environmental sustainability. In these simulations, players can create renewable energy systems, design eco-friendly infrastructure, and implement policies to manage natural resources. By allowing players to see the consequences of their decisions, these games make climate change tangible, providing both entertainment and education.
  • Challenges and Rewards: Climate activists can use XR to create gamified challenges that encourage individuals to adopt sustainable practices in their daily lives. For example, an app might challenge users to reduce their carbon footprint or increase recycling, rewarding them with digital tokens or recognition for their efforts. This gamification aspect helps to make sustainability practices more engaging and enjoyable.

3. Providing Real-Time Environmental Data

AR and MR technologies allow for the integration of real-time environmental data into physical spaces. This can be used to educate the public and influence behavior by making environmental issues more visible and understandable.

  • Interactive Climate Data Visualization: Activists and environmental organizations can use AR to visualize real-time environmental data on a physical landscape. For instance, a person using an AR headset could walk through a park and see a visualization of how much CO2 the trees in that park are absorbing or how the temperature has increased over the past few decades. This interaction can transform abstract concepts like carbon sequestration or global warming into tangible, easy-to-understand visuals.
  • Urban Sustainability Projects: In cities, MR can be used to simulate climate-friendly solutions, such as green roofs, solar panels, or wind turbines, in real time. City planners and activists can use these simulations to demonstrate the potential benefits of sustainable urban practices, promoting awareness about eco-friendly technologies and policies.
  • Interactive Campaigns: Through XR technologies, activists can use interactive campaigns to directly involve the public. For example, users might scan a QR code in a public space to view an AR simulation of the future impact of climate change in their city or region. This localized approach makes the climate crisis more relevant and personal, encouraging citizens to take action at the local level.

4. Enhancing Education and Advocacy

XR technologies are also being used to provide in-depth education about climate change, environmental conservation, and the science behind it. These tools enable deeper learning and more effective advocacy.

  • Virtual Classes and Workshops: XR can be used to deliver immersive, virtual classes or workshops on topics related to climate science, sustainability, and environmental advocacy. Students can take virtual field trips to endangered ecosystems or experience the science behind renewable energy, increasing their understanding of environmental issues.
  • Activist Training Simulations: XR offers new ways for climate change activists to train for real-world actions. By creating virtual simulations of protest scenarios, campaigns, or lobbying meetings, activists can practice their strategies in a controlled, risk-free environment. This helps activists build skills and confidence while spreading awareness about key climate issues.

Benefits of XR for Climate Change Activism

  • Increased Engagement: XR technologies foster deeper engagement by immersing individuals in interactive and emotional experiences. This level of engagement is more impactful than traditional methods of activism, such as reading articles or watching videos.
  • Global Reach: XR has the potential to connect climate change activists across the globe, transcending geographic and cultural barriers. Virtual events, campaigns, and protests allow people from all walks of life to unite around shared climate goals, amplifying the global movement.
  • Real-Time Impact: By utilizing real-time data, XR provides an up-to-the-minute understanding of the state of the environment, enabling activists to respond promptly to emerging threats. This can include tracking deforestation, air pollution, or climate-induced natural disasters, allowing immediate action to be taken.
  • Empathy and Awareness: XR’s immersive experiences make environmental issues feel real and urgent, fostering empathy and personal connection with those affected by climate change. This helps to inspire activism from individuals who might not otherwise feel motivated to act.

Challenges and Considerations

While XR offers promising solutions for climate change activism, there are several challenges to consider:

  • Cost and Accessibility: XR technologies, especially VR and MR, can be costly to develop and access. This might limit their widespread use, particularly in underserved or marginalized communities. Ensuring equitable access to XR tools is a significant challenge for the climate change movement.
  • Technological Barriers: Not everyone has access to the hardware necessary for fully immersive XR experiences, such as VR headsets or AR-enabled devices. Activists must consider these limitations when developing XR content and strive to create accessible solutions.
  • Data Privacy and Security: XR platforms require large amounts of data, and ensuring user privacy is crucial. Activists must take care to protect user information and avoid exploiting personal data.
